Mauritania highlights religious education |
2014-11-20 |
[MAGHAREBIA] Mauritania just approved an increase in the time allocated for Islamic and religious education (IMCR) in secondary schools. As a result of the decision by the education minister, religion will now be a compulsory subject for the baccalaureate. The November 4th move, which was welcomed by pupils and civil society organisations, aims at initiating young people into a moderate, middle-ground form of Islam, teaching the virtues of the religion and avoiding false interpretations that lead to extremism. |
